What should I expect to pay for travel agent services in Columbia, AL?

Many Columbia travel agents earn commissions from suppliers rather than charging direct fees, especially for standard bookings. For customized itineraries (e.g., multi-generational family reunions at Lake Eufaula), they may charge a planning fee of $50-$150, which is often waived if you book through them.
